Origin Access, the subscription based gaming service by Electronic Arts, has just taken a few steps towards sweetening the deal by adding four new games to the package.

These games are Cities Skylines, Darksiders Warmastered Edition, Orwell: Ignorance is Strength and Rime. With these four games added to Origin Access, the total number of games available with the service has now increased to a total of 114 titles.

Other games included with the service are Mass Effect: Andromeda, Star Wars Battlefront Ultimate Edition, Mad Max, Battlefield 4, Unravel, Crysis 3, The Sexy Brutale and the massively underrated Titanfall 2, which alone makes the service worth buying in my honest opinion.

One thing to keep in mind however is that this is not EA Access, which is a similar service available on the Xbox One. All of the games listed above, and the full 114 found here, are only available for the PC through EA’s own Origin platform.
